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54640 36943644929 58041086 77011 3080
051306 1200
051306 1200
640779 114 155642 78
All about undefined
Interested in learning more?
051306 1200
640779 114 155642 78
See more
93370853 8174529 3389341
101428323 5337621155 61 75855 5269581
See more
2426429 266580933 59784262047
4041 8048515243 886 58535
See more